Allotting completely one special branch in chemistry to compounds of only one element. Is it justified when there are so many elements and their com¬pounds but not with any special branches ?

  1. We understand that all molecules that make life possible carbohydrates, proteins, nucleic acids, lipids, hormones and vitamins contain carbon.
  2. The chemical reactions that take place in living systems are of carbon com-pounds.
  3. Food that we get from nature, various medicines, cotton, silk and fuels like natural gas and petroleum almost all of them are carbon compounds.
  4. Synthetic fabrics, plastics, synthetic rubber are also compounds of carbon.
  5. Hence, carbon is a special element with the largest number of compounds.
